Gioia 20 is located in a new area of Milan where a project must simultaneously respond to different themes, while interacting with the city and bringing new value to it.

We have chosen to fullfill each of the fundamental themes of a project: program, functionality, sustainability, urban relationships and their rules, and, of course, architecture. each of the fundamental themes of a project: program, functionality, sustainability, urban relationships and their rules, and of course architecture.
The building conquers its highest vertical dimension, distinguishing itself in different ways according to its various facades and, consequently, to its relationship with the context. Extremely vertical towards west, volumetrically enclosed between a vertical line and a diagonal line towards south, stratified to the east.
A surface that gradually becomes a line and ends in a point, rarefying towards the sky, becoming one with it.
The sequence of floors alternates along the vertical and the diagonal, in a series of double or triple height collective spaces (meeting rooms, break areas, etc), like glass boxes placed on the gradient line where the surface is treated with ceramics, in continuity with Gio Ponti’s tradition and heritage.
